Because of the rise of dual-income households and non-traditional work hours, the interest in 24-hour daycare solutions has been steadily increasing. 24-hour daycare centers provide moms and dads the flexibility they need to balance work and family duties, and offer a secure and nurturing environment for kids night and day.

Advantages of 24-Hour Daycare:

Among key benefits of 24-hour daycare could be the freedom it includes working moms and dads. Many moms and dads work changes that increase beyond standard daycare hours, which makes it difficult to acquire childcare that fits their schedule. 24-hour daycare centers solve this problem by providing treatment during nights, weekends, as well as overnight. This permits moms and dads to operate without worrying about finding you to definitely view their children during non-traditional hours.

Another advantageous asset of 24-hour daycare could be the satisfaction it offers to moms and dads. Comprehending that kids are now being taken care of by trained experts in a secure and secure environment can alleviate the anxiety and shame very often includes leaving young ones in daycare. Parents can consider their particular work realizing that their children are in good fingers, which could lead to increased output and task satisfaction.

Additionally, 24-hour daycare centers can provide a feeling of neighborhood and help for households. Parents whom work non-traditional hours often battle to discover childcare choices that meet their demands, ultimately causing thoughts of separation and stress. 24-hour daycare facilities will offer a feeling of that belong and camaraderie among moms and dads dealing with similar difficulties, creating a support system that will help households thrive.

Difficulties of 24-Hour Daycare:

While 24-hour daycare facilities offer benefits, additionally they include their own collection of difficulties. One of the greatest challenges is staffing. Finding competent and dependable childcare providers who will be willing to work non-traditional hours may be hard, leading to high return rates and possible staffing shortages. This will influence the grade of treatment provided to kiddies and create instability for families depending on 24-hour daycare services.

Regulation and Oversight:

Being make sure the security and well-being of children in 24-hour daycare facilities, regulation and oversight are necessary. State and regional governments put criteria for licensing and accreditation of daycare centers, including the ones that operate around the clock. These requirements cover a wide range of places, including staff-to-child ratios, health and safety needs, and staff education and skills.

Besides government regulations, numerous 24-hour daycare centers choose to look for certification from nationwide businesses for instance the National Association when it comes to knowledge of small children (NAEYC) and/or nationwide Association for Family childcare (NAFCC). Accreditation demonstrates dedication to high-quality treatment and will help moms and dads feel confident within their selection of childcare provider.
